Sanni gets backing for Kwara Utd job

Date: 2015-01-19

Kwara United supporters have thrown their weight behind former manager, Tunde Sanni to return to the helm of the Afonja Warriors.

The Ilorin-based club are still yet to name their new technical adviser for this year after the contract of all the technical crew that were in charge last season expired.

Supersport.com gathered that none of the technical crew members that were in charge last season would return.

The source revealed that a thorough screening is currently going on by the management of the Ilorin-based team on who will handle the team next term in the Nigeria Professional Football League (NPFL).

But some Kwara United faithful have now demonstrated openly and have declared their support to have Sanni back in charge of the team this year.

"We want Sanni to return to the helm of Kwara United," A number of the club fans chorused.

Others simply said: "He is our choice."

Last week, a top source revealed to supersport.com that Sanni, who was at the helm of Kwara United three seasons ago, is now highly favoured to return as the technical adviser pending final endorsement from the government house.

Meanwhile, it is now expected that Kwara United would name their new trainer that will be in charge this year any moment from now.
